As a result of the MCO, the Company's audit for the 2020 financial results has been delayed as the Company's finance team and its auditors have been unable to enter the office premises. While work has commenced remotely, this only provides limited access to the Company's accounting systems and supporting documents. Consequently, the Company applied for a three-month extension for the publication of its annual report and accounts for 2020, and it has received approval from AIM and the Jersey Financial Services Commission. As a result, the Company will publish its annual report and audited results for 2020 by 30 September 2021.
